    Quote from Gortat

    Marcin Gortat, for one, is concerned Brooks might play a bit too much one on five basketball as he tries to put on a show for his old fans and prove the Rockets made a mistake dealing him.

    “I’m just scared it’s going to be an Aaron Brooks versus the Houston Rockets, that’s what I’m scared of,” Gortat said. “I’m just scared it’s going to be one big game, and I know Aaron is going to want to have a good game over there just like I want to have it here [against Orlando]. It’s going to be frustrating if Steve’s not playing, for real. I’m going to be the guy missing him the most, trust me.”
